A balanced Y-connected load?
A balanced Y-connected load is connected at the end of a three phase generator as
shown in Figure Q1. The line impedance is Zline = 0.12 + j0.09ohms. The total power to
the balanced load is 6912 Watts and the phase voltage at the load is 120 Volts. Using
the single phase equivalent circuit, calculate:
(a) The phase current at the load, Ia
(b) The generator phase voltage, EAN and the generator line voltage, EBC.
Notes: i) Assume positive sequences and select ‘Van’ at the load as reference.
ii) All the answers must be in polar form (magnitude and angle) and in 2 decimal
places.
